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91091256127 650782788 8141
98 31345732938
98 31345732938
9689835057 8581 320327 883058
All about undefined
Interested in learning more?
98 31345732938
9689835057 8581 320327 883058
See more
56232343 048134341
496466063 1824918473 8937572
See more
8394716 741995090
36 263596 067054 607 32
See more